I appreciate the effort, but if I'm following correctly I don't believe 
this will work.  I went through recompiling the kernel with the option 
and creating a package much like what I see there.  However, this then 
lacks the associated restricted modules package for the nvidia driver 
and atheros wireless.  In looking into recompiling those packages hit a 
number of stumbling blocks which eventually led me to filing the request 
for this to be enabled in the existing package alongside the other 
ftrace options.

Without the associated restricted modules the trace isn't much of an 
apples to apples comparison and likely the issue would not be able to be 
reproduced as it only seems to occur when the wireless is in use.
